WebDisplacement (psychology) In psychology, displacement ( German: Verschiebung, lit. 'shift, move') is an unconscious defence mechanism whereby the mind substitutes either a new aim or a new object for goals felt in their original form to be dangerous or unacceptable. The subconscious mind (called "preconscious" by Freud): This level is 60% of the iceberg. It is underwater but not deep down. It contains stored memory, information, habits, and anything that you could potentially pull into conscious awareness. WebThe new prose of Ernest Hemingway and the new psychology of Sigmund Freud share some remarkably similar assumptions. The new prose was designed to communicate on two levels simultaneously: the explicit and the implicit. And, as the iceberg analogy suggests, the deceptively simple sur-face of the story rested upon a broader, more complex, hidden ...
